ON THE COVER Barrett Coke playing for the Coke family’s Chanticleer Farm polo team, which won the Chairman’s Cup for the second year in a row. Barrett was a three time all-star Northeast National Youth Polo Player and winner of the 2015 National Youth Tournament Series Championships. Photograph by Andrew Katsampes
